| | The Rudy Vallee Hour |
 | | Rudy Vallee was then heard over WOR for 30 minutes weekdays featuring mostly records and talk from 02/20/50 to 04/27/51. |  | | His final appearance was over CBS from 02/27/55 to 06/19/55 for Kraft, again featuring mostly records and talk, but for 60 minutes on Sundays. |  | | The first time Rudy Vallee was heard on the radio was in 1928 over WABC. |

| | Calypso: Guests of Rudy Vallee |
 | | During their 1934 recording trip to New York, Lion and Atilla were heard by popular singer Rudy Vallee, who arranged for the pair to appear on his nationwide radio broadcast on NBC. |  | | Lion and Atilla later wrote a calypso that chronicled this experience. |

| | Rudy Vallée biography : albums : icebergradio.com |
 | | Famed for singing through a megaphone and introducing his performances with a salutary "Heigh-Ho, Everybody," Vallée recorded into the mid-'40s and enjoyed a renaissance during the '60s after high-profile appearances on Broadway. |  | | Vallée continued to appear in films until the mid-'70s, and performed around the country up to his death ten years later. |  | | One of the most popular entertainers of the 1930s, Rudy Vallée was one of the few vocalists to begin crooning before the advent of Bing Crosby. |
